Hindustan Unilever Limited is continuing to expand its reach across emerging channels while reinforcing its core general trade network to support long term growth.

Hindustan Unilever Limited recorded a doubling of sales from hyperlocal delivery platforms in FY26 while its ecommerce business grew by more than 25 per cent highlighting the company’s accelerating focus on digital and omni channel expansion.

The company has established a dedicated Q-commerce team, strengthening its omni-channel execution as part of its strategy to tap into fast-growing digital channels, said its MD and CEO, Priya Nair, on Thursday.

"We have a dedicated team now for quick commerce and e-commerce, and we are also investing in general trade capabilities," Nair said, adding that the company has also created focused teams for open-format stores and chemist channels, which are witnessing strong growth even within traditional trade.

Hindustan Unilever Limited said its ecommerce business posted turnover growth of more than 25 per cent in FY26 driven by digital first assortments data led demand generation and stronger product availability across platforms.

The company added that its omni channel strategy integrating digital and offline distribution channels is beginning to show results supporting faster growth across categories.

"Building capabilities across channels and strengthening execution is enabling us to step up growth, and this strategy is now beginning to show outcomes," Nair added.

While the company has not disclosed specific revenue contribution from these channels some reports indicate that they accounted for nearly 3 per cent of its topline in the third quarter.

For FY26 Hindustan Unilever Limited reported total revenue of ₹65,219 crore.
